Bennett & Game are working with a well-established regional contractor based in Portsmouth, delivering a diverse range of commercial, residential, refurbishment and fit-out projects across the South. With a forecast turnover of £14m this year and a strong pipeline of secured work, the business continues to grow and is now looking to appoint an Assistant Quantity Surveyor to support their expanding commercial team. Project values range from £15k to £7M.

This is an excellent opportunity for an Assistant Quantity Surveyor seeking structured progression within a supportive commercial environment, with clear development towards Quantity Surveyor level. The role is based out of their Portsmouth office, offering hybrid working and regular site visits across the region.

Job Overview

Supporting the commercial team across a varied project portfolio:

  • Assisting with valuations, variations, cost reporting and final accounts
  • Supporting subcontract procurement and general commercial administration
  • Conducting site visits and liaising with operational teams
  • Assisting with tenders, cost planning and commercial reporting
  • Maintaining accurate project records and supporting contract compliance
Job Requirements
  • Experience within main contracting or fit-out/refurbishment environments
  • Suitable for Assistant Quantity Surveyors looking to progress
  • Strong numerical, commercial and contractual awareness
  • Good communication and organisational skills
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ines
  • Full UK driving licence
